對(duì)“挖坑程序員”的思考
我在Twitter上看到一幅有趣的圖片。我不是來(lái)責(zé)備發(fā)帖的這個(gè)人,也不是責(zé)備轉(zhuǎn)發(fā)的人或圖的原作者。但如果不說(shuō)出我對(duì)這個(gè)圖的背后的一些思考,我會(huì)憋得難受。
上面的圖中,程序員被描繪成一個(gè)挖坑人。這Twitter帳號(hào)明顯屬于一個(gè)程序員,這幅圖的標(biāo)題被寫(xiě)成“悲慘,但卻是事實(shí)…”
我毫不同情這挖坑的程序員。因?yàn)槲也幌嘈艜?huì)有這樣的事情。
很容易我們會(huì)想到那個(gè)鐵鏟子是鍵盤(pán)的比喻,但我從來(lái)沒(méi)遇到過(guò)自己作為一個(gè)程序員努力的干活兒的同時(shí),一幫“經(jīng)理們”在那指手畫(huà)腳的說(shuō)挖什么,在哪挖,如何挖的場(chǎng)景。我也不認(rèn)為其他程序員會(huì)有這樣的經(jīng)歷。
相 比起圖片中圍繞著我們那個(gè)努力干活的兄弟的10個(gè)人,實(shí)際工作中我會(huì)遇到比這還要多的做管理的人。企業(yè)里都有很多管理人員,但管理人員也是要干活的。如果 你盲目的在那里挖坑,而他們只是站在那里觀看,那你從我這里得不到半點(diǎn)贊譽(yù)。從坑里爬出來(lái),用鐵鍬打他們的頭。(免責(zé)聲明:我并不支持用真的鐵鏟去打這些 低能的技術(shù)寄生蟲(chóng),但是抗?fàn)庍€是龜縮,那要看你自己了。)
我知道一個(gè)程序員拿這種事情開(kāi)管理人員的玩笑有點(diǎn)反應(yīng)過(guò)度,但我知道很多人真的相信圖中的情形。如果作為一個(gè)程序員,你對(duì)那個(gè)挖坑的家伙深有同感,我要?jiǎng)衲阙s緊辭職。如果做為一個(gè)程序員,你感覺(jué)被迫去挖坑,趕緊走人。外面有很多你可以逃難的地方。
編 程是科學(xué)和藝術(shù)結(jié)合的美麗產(chǎn)物。你可以自由的去推理,自由的表現(xiàn)。好的管理會(huì)提供環(huán)境給你,會(huì)對(duì)你說(shuō),“嗨,我想我們解決問(wèn)題的方法是在這里挖個(gè)坑,但我 想我們需要一個(gè)比鏟子更強(qiáng)的工具來(lái)完成這個(gè)。”我不同情那些處在壓迫蹂躪中的程序員,我跟那些把自己比作用鏟子挖坑的人的程序員劃清界線。
但我敬佩干這種工作的人,有了他們,我們才不用去干這些事情。
原文鏈接:http://www.devmynd.com/blog/2013-2-on-programmers-as-ditch-diggers